Страница 1 из 2 12 ПоследняяПоследняя
Показано с 1 по 10 из 15

Тема: CП307-P запись на флеш

  1. #1

    По умолчанию CП307-P запись на флеш

    Безымянный.JPG

    если цикл взять секунда, то в файл сохраняет, правда проскакивает через отсчётов 30-40 по 10-20 пустых строчек или с мусором
    если выбираю минуту - всё, не пишет.

    как это работает?

  2. #2

    По умолчанию

    Обязательно ли использовать бит управления?

  3. #3
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    12,161

    По умолчанию

    Цитата Сообщение от Владимир Технос М Посмотреть сообщение
    Обязательно ли использовать бит управления?
    Нет.

    Описание элемента Архивирование на USB приведено в РП.

    В аттаче пример ведения архива с помощью функциональной области (он тоже рассмотрен в РП).
    Вложения Вложения

  4. #4
    Пользователь Аватар для petera
    Регистрация
    06.05.2011
    Адрес
    Минск
    Сообщений
    3,841

    По умолчанию

    Цитата Сообщение от Владимир Технос М Посмотреть сообщение
    Безымянный.JPG

    если цикл взять секунда, то в файл сохраняет, правда проскакивает через отсчётов 30-40 по 10-20 пустых строчек или с мусором
    если выбираю минуту - всё, не пишет.

    как это работает?
    На самом деле выборка работает с регистрами панели (см. вкладку "Хранилище")
    Как только наберется 60 записей, то они скидываются на флешку.
    В вашем случае один раз в час. По этому и кажется, что "...все, не пишет"

    ЗЫ, Кроме того Вы ничего не сказали, какую переменную архивируете, может это регистр PSW 256 или другой из области хранилища. Ведь по умолчанию хранилище начинается с регистра PSW256 и занимает в вашем случае область по PSW687(если используется дата и время).
    И вполне возможно, что Вы сами, используя эти регистры где-нибудь еще, портите выборку, по тому и "мусор"
    Последний раз редактировалось petera; 27.05.2016 в 14:20.
    Мой канал на ютубе
    https://www.youtube.com/c/ПетрАртюков
    Библиотека ГМ для СП300
    https://disk.yandex.com/d/gHLMhLi8x1_HBg

  5. #5

    По умолчанию

    Цитата Сообщение от petera Посмотреть сообщение
    ЗЫ, Кроме того Вы ничего не сказали, какую переменную архивируете, может это регистр PSW 256 или другой из области хранилища. Ведь по умолчанию хранилище начинается с регистра PSW256 и занимает в вашем случае область по PSW687(если используется дата и время).
    И вполне возможно, что Вы сами, используя эти регистры где-нибудь еще, портите выборку, по тому и "мусор"
    Архивирую много переменных.., и совсем не понятно с размером хранилища Безымянный.JPG

  6. #6
    Пользователь Аватар для petera
    Регистрация
    06.05.2011
    Адрес
    Минск
    Сообщений
    3,841

    По умолчанию

    Цитата Сообщение от Владимир Технос М Посмотреть сообщение
    Архивирую много переменных.., и совсем не понятно с размером хранилища Безымянный.JPG
    Мало информации сколько переменных, это регистры ПЛК или панели, формат Word/DWord.
    Размер хранилища для выборки, т.е. архива, можно подсчитать здесь http://www.owen.ru/forum/showthread....l=1#post139595

    ЗЫ Для одной переменной Word, при 60 точках( почему-то назвали кол.записей в файле) нужно 431 регистр
    4+(60+1)*(1+6)=431
    Для двух переменных
    4+(60+1)*(2+6)=492
    для трех
    4+(60+1)*(3+6)=553
    и т.д.

    Глядите, чтобы Ваш архив не пересекался с другими архивами или графиками.

    ЗЫ2.
    Естественно в качестве хранилища можно использовать PFW, тогда освободите регистры PSW для своих нужд и кроме того не записанный вовремя архив перед отключением питания не пропадет.
    Последний раз редактировалось petera; 27.05.2016 в 14:51.
    Мой канал на ютубе
    https://www.youtube.com/c/ПетрАртюков
    Библиотека ГМ для СП300
    https://disk.yandex.com/d/gHLMhLi8x1_HBg

  7. #7

    По умолчанию

    Безымянный.JPG

    переменных много, и Word и Вооl а как задать диапазон для хранилища? Пост выше место только для одного регистра ..

  8. #8
    Пользователь Аватар для petera
    Регистрация
    06.05.2011
    Адрес
    Минск
    Сообщений
    3,841

    По умолчанию

    Цитата Сообщение от Владимир Технос М Посмотреть сообщение


    переменных много, и Word и Вооl а как задать диапазон для хранилища? Пост выше место только для одного регистра ..
    Формула в посте по ссылке
    Для выборки
    N=4+(n+1)*(Kw+2*Kdw+6) регистров, если выбран способ "ymrhms"
    или
    N=4+(n+1)*(Kw+2*Kdw) регистров, если выбран способ "none".
    где n-количество записей в выборке, заданное в ее настройках, см первый рисунок.
    Kw-количество переменных Word
    Kdw--количество переменных DWord
    Как Вы умудряетесь переменные Вооl архивировать?

    ЗЫ. В новой панели можно еще и String архивировать, естественно в формуле этого нет.
    Мой канал на ютубе
    https://www.youtube.com/c/ПетрАртюков
    Библиотека ГМ для СП300
    https://disk.yandex.com/d/gHLMhLi8x1_HBg

  9. #9

    По умолчанию

    Цитата Сообщение от petera Посмотреть сообщение
    Как Вы умудряетесь переменные Вооl архивировать?
    ЗЫ. В новой панели можно еще и String архивировать, естественно в формуле этого нет.
    Безымянный.JPG

    вот так..., но сейчас закралось сомнение будет ли работать.., ещё не проверил.
    А string в моей панели есть!

  10. #10
    Пользователь Аватар для petera
    Регистрация
    06.05.2011
    Адрес
    Минск
    Сообщений
    3,841

    По умолчанию

    Цитата Сообщение от Владимир Технос М Посмотреть сообщение
    Безымянный.JPG

    вот так..., но сейчас закралось сомнение будет ли работать.., ещё не проверил.
    А string в моей панели есть!
    Ну и где здесь битовая переменная?
    Захват-1.png

    В файле в столбце для этой переменной будет число типа 1,234 с тремя знаками после запятой
    Мой канал на ютубе
    https://www.youtube.com/c/ПетрАртюков
    Библиотека ГМ для СП300
    https://disk.yandex.com/d/gHLMhLi8x1_HBg

Страница 1 из 2 12 ПоследняяПоследняя

Похожие темы

  1. запись переменной в флеш память плк
    от alexval2006 в разделе ПЛК1хх
    Ответов: 11
    Последнее сообщение: 12.05.2020, 12:18
  2. Ответов: 4
    Последнее сообщение: 24.06.2019, 14:56
  3. СПК-107 (Запись на флеш через файл)
    от ru522464 в разделе СПК1хх
    Ответов: 1
    Последнее сообщение: 27.02.2014, 13:54
  4. Запись переменных на флеш или SD карту.
    от MikiMouse в разделе Помощь Разработчикам
    Ответов: 2
    Последнее сообщение: 05.12.2013, 12:17
  5. Ответов: 4
    Последнее сообщение: 03.02.2013, 19:23

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•